## Baseline File

Plugins for the Lintharbor SDK are checked against baseline.lock, our static-analysis baseline. It records known findings so CI only fails on new issues. Never edit the baseline by hand; regenerate it with the refresh task and commit the diff. Suppressing a finding requires a justification comment. Baselines older than 90 days are rejected. For regeneration problems or suppression reviews, write to the address below.

pager mailbox: silael.sorwyn.tamius@zemvarsys.corp

Handover for the sync: I got the bulk-edit checkboxes in the Kestrelboard admin table working, but the batch-size throttle is still hardcoded. Priya, if you pick this up, the multi-row save path is in AdminGrid.apply(). Watch for stale row versions on concurrent edits. The current settings the staging service runs with are listed below.

settings of yageg-yahap:
[gorael]
team = olieth
access_code = ac_941d74
owner = brieth.aldiel
host = gorael.tolvaqio.internal
port = 6379
peer = briwyn.urlaqtech.internal
salt = 116e6622
pin = 1957

// Order cutoff logic for the Crumbline bakery app.
// Orders placed after the cutoff roll to the next bake day,
// except rush orders, which get a shorter grace window.
// Don't "just bump the cutoff" — the ovens at the Marlow Street
// kitchen genuinely can't absorb it. The tuning knobs live below.

tuning table, yajog-yahof:
BUDGETS = {
    "lamvan": 303,
    "wenox": 460,
    "fenvan": 525,
}

Handover — Loyalty Overhaul

To: incoming director. Harrowgate pilot done; results with Fenna. Tier migration scripts tested, rollout paused pending pricing sign-off. Branch managers briefed except Westmoor. Vendor contract with Opaline Systems renews in May — renegotiate. Watch redemption spikes in week one. Keep branch comms weekly. Plan details directly below.

board note of kajeg-taduf: The pricing group signed off on a budget of $23.8 million for Project Istys. The renewal with Norwynix Group closes at $56.9 million a year, 52 percent above the last contract.